About the Role

The EBITDA Improvement Analyst supports the identification, analysis, and monitoring of initiatives that drive improvements to the organisation’s EBITDA. This role collaborates cross-functionally to provide analytical insights that enhance revenue, optimise costs, and drive operational efficiency, ultimately improving business profitability and long-term value creation. The role combines financial modelling, data analysis, commercial acumen, and reporting to support the delivery of measurable outcomes aligned with strategic and financial objectives.

Responsibilities

  • Conduct detailed financial modelling and data analysis to identify key drivers of EBITDA performance.
  • Highlight opportunities for improvement across the business.
  • Support cost reduction initiatives and margin improvement strategies.
  • Analyse spend across operational, procurement and support functions.
  • Analyse data relating to revenue growth, pricing, product and channel mix.
  • Review customer churn and other commercial drivers to uncover actionable insights.
  • Assist in tracking the delivery of EBITDA improvement projects.
  • Maintain accurate logs of project timelines, budgets and ROI targets.
  • Maintain, update and develop KPIs and dashboards.
  • Monitor financial improvement initiatives and provide clear visibility to management.
  • Collaborate with Finance, Operations, Sales, Procurement, HR and other departments.
  • Gather relevant data and provide analytical support for change and improvement initiatives.
  • Prepare high-quality reports, data visualisations and commercial analysis.
  • Provide clear insights for senior leaders, boards and investment stakeholders.
  • Assist in building financial models for strategic initiatives.
  • Develop business cases for transformation projects and investment opportunities.
  • Support the analysis and execution of pricing strategies across product offerings.
  • Ensure pricing decisions align with EBITDA improvement targets.
  • Analyse pricing performance and margin outcomes across channels and products.
  • Maintain and utilise pricing models and tools to improve pricing visibility, margin position and profitability analysis.
  • Provide data-driven insights and analytical support for pricing recommendations on new products and services.

About the Company

  • Smart Energy is one of Australia’s leading home electrification and renewable energy businesses, helping Australian homeowners reduce their energy costs and get more from their homes.
  • We provide customers with a range of home energy solutions including solar, battery storage, hot water heat pumps, EV charging and other home electrification products, helping households transition towards smarter, cleaner and more energy-efficient homes.
  • Since launching in 2016, Smart Energy has grown to more than 300 employees across Australia, with teams operating nationwide and our Head Office based in beautiful Byron Bay.
  • Backed by the strength and stability of Rinnai Australia, we're entering an exciting phase of growth as we continue expanding our products, technology, customer offering and national footprint.
